Cláudia Lima (born 5 September 1996) is a Portuguese footballer who plays as a midfielder and has appeared for the Portugal women's national team.[1]

Career[]

Lima has been capped for the Portugal national team, appearing for the team during the 2019 FIFA Women's World Cup qualifying cycle.[2]
